About Relax Gaming

Relax Gaming is a business-to-business iGaming supplier and content aggregator, founded in 2010 and headquartered in Malta. It develops its own slots, poker and bingo products and distributes thousands of third-party casino games through its Silver Bullet and Powered By partner programmes. Owned by the Kindred Group (now part of FDJ United), the company runs game studios in Belgrade, Novi Sad, Malmö and Stockholm, with additional offices across Europe and Gibraltar. Relax Gaming supplies regulated online casino operators worldwide.
